    As a new player when I draw a new tile why can't I put it into my hand before deciding what to discard? This helps me to see what shapes I have and what to cut next.

    • @RiichiNomi
      @RiichiNomi  6 дней назад +1

      Great question! This ultimately goes back to curtesy of the other players in the tables as they also need to see from where in your hand you discarded a tile. This goes back to potential cheating tactics as well!
      You can avoid this by placing the tile on top of the tiles already in your hand as a way to still have a way of figuring out your way while also being mindful of the players. The more you play the easier it will be for you to figure out your ways without needing to place them in your hand!
